Our client, a prominent player in luxury retail, is seeking an Ecommerce Project Coordinator to enhance their online presence and drive website growth. Based in London with flexible and hybrid working, this role is a crucial part of their Ecommerce strategy.

The ideal candidate will be target driven and passionate about reaching business performance KPI’s and customer expectations. You will be expected to understand the websites performance by using analytics tools and working closely alongside the Insight and web dev team in order to make daily recommendations of amendments. This role also requires a strong commercial flair and excellent communication and organisation skills. This role will also involve stakeholder management and project tracking.

Main Responsibilities of the Ecommerce Project Coordinator:

  • Have a strong understanding of trading performance such as traffic behaviour and conversion triggers and feed this in team meetings.
  • Collaborate with internal and external stakeholders as well as coordination of meetings associated to ecommerce, technology and development
  • You will have to assist with the day to day maintenance and development of the business’ e-commerce websites
  • You will be in charge of feedback gathering, project tracking and roadmap management
  • Using web analytics tools and working with the Dev and Insight Team, you will monitor performance of all the key elements of the website to understand the success of the promotional programme.
  • Carrying out full site audits, ensuring all current stock is displayed online correctly.

The Ideal Candidate:

  • Proven experience in a similar eCommerce role and project coordination (specially in the technical and digital space)
  • Good understanding of Shopify or Magento or Woocommerce, analytics tools and adobe
  • In-depth understanding of key trends, seasonality, banner clicks, traffic behaviour and conversion triggers.
  • Strong communication skills with other team members and departments
  • Passionate and target driven.
